This might be a stupid question, but I've never seen anything about it before. When pressing ctrl+s, this little bar comes up that allows you to enter a string of text into it, and I'd like to know what it does before I go screwing around with it.

If you hit ctrl-r, the game will record your key presses until you hit ctrl-r again. This creates a macro that you can play back with ctrl-p. Ctrl-s allows you to save the currently-active macro, and ctrl-l allows you to load a saved macro as the current macro (so you can play it back with ctrl-p).

These are in fact quite useful and make many functions quite a bit faster and easier than they otherwise would be. I've got macros to queue a full set of steel armor at the manager, which would otherwise take close to 100 keystroke, another to queue 100 rock blocks, one to queue the makings of a green glass pump, one for selecting everything on one z-level of the map, one to select a whole page on the "bring items to depot" screeen (also useful for on the trade screen itself), and others that I don't use so often.
